FS#45253 - [AUR 4] Cannot upload packages with empty source=()

DetailsSome packages, such as https://aur.archlinux.org/packages/zenbound2/ , don't have a source= line, but require the user to manually download a file and put it in the appropriate place. Currently AUR 4 rejects these packages with:
remote: Traceback (most recent call last): remote: File "hooks/update", line 241, in <module> remote: for fname in pkginfo['source']: remote: KeyError: 'source' remote: error: hook declined to update refs/heads/master |
